Transaction 06073875c5525f5b6a8f10621b7f6063d293575cc98d89d93996f3c9abc98b18
1 Input
1 Output
-
06073875c5525f5b6a8f10621b7f6063d293575cc98d89d93996f3c9abc98b18:0
- value
- 646692
- script pubkey
- OP_0 OP_PUSHBYTES_32 8b2de68efb255230241cf76bb8361741d053cadd59125ee8c13c6150329c57ed
- address
- bc1q3vk7drhmy4frqfqu7a4msdshg8g98jkatyf9a6xp83s4qv5u2lksx9rq02